An excellent example of Pennsylvania cabinetmaking, this cupboard has a bold cornice, a two-door glass top with fluted quarter columns and candle drawers over a two drawer and door base with nice base molding and bold ogee feet. The cupboard has an exceptional old finish. Pennsylvania, c. 1770-80. H 88.5” | W 56.75” | D 21”
